The annual salary statistics of bailiffs in Indianapolis-Carmel, Indiana is shown in Table 1. The wage statistics of bailiffs in Indianapolis-Carmel is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$33,980 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$33,980 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$44,410 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$45,500 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$49,100 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for bailiffs in Indianapolis-Carmel, Indiana in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$49,100.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$44,410.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$33,980.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of bailiffs from 2012 to 2022.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 10-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2022 | $44,410 | 10.38% | 21.50% |
| 2021 | $39,800 | 7.61% | - |
| 2020 | $36,770 | 2.31% | - |
| 2019 | $35,920 | -1.00% | - |
| 2018 | $36,280 | 2.70% | - |
| 2017 | $35,300 | 1.25% | - |
| 2016 | $34,860 | 0.40% | - |
| 2015 | $34,720 | 2.22% | - |
| 2014 | $33,950 | 5.68% | - |
| 2013 | $32,020 | -8.87% | - |
| 2012 | $34,860 | - | - |
